Udostępnij za pośrednictwem


CookieSigningInContext Klasa

Definicja

Obiekt kontekstu przekazany do obiektu SigningIn(CookieSigningInContext).

public ref class CookieSigningInContext : Microsoft::AspNetCore::Authentication::Cookies::BaseCookieContext
public ref class CookieSigningInContext : Microsoft::AspNetCore::Authentication::PrincipalContext<Microsoft::AspNetCore::Authentication::Cookies::CookieAuthenticationOptions ^>
public class CookieSigningInContext : Microsoft.AspNetCore.Authentication.Cookies.BaseCookieContext
public class CookieSigningInContext : Microsoft.AspNetCore.Authentication.PrincipalContext<Microsoft.AspNetCore.Authentication.Cookies.CookieAuthenticationOptions>
type CookieSigningInContext = class
    inherit BaseCookieContext
type CookieSigningInContext = class
    inherit PrincipalContext<CookieAuthenticationOptions>
Public Class CookieSigningInContext
Inherits BaseCookieContext
Public Class CookieSigningInContext
Inherits PrincipalContext(Of CookieAuthenticationOptions)
Dziedziczenie
CookieSigningInContext
Dziedziczenie

Konstruktory

CookieSigningInContext(HttpContext, AuthenticationScheme, CookieAuthenticationOptions, ClaimsPrincipal, AuthenticationProperties, CookieOptions)

Tworzy nowe wystąpienie obiektu kontekstu.

CookieSigningInContext(HttpContext, CookieAuthenticationOptions, String, ClaimsPrincipal, AuthenticationProperties, CookieOptions)

Tworzy nowe wystąpienie obiektu kontekstu.

Właściwości

AuthenticationScheme

Nazwa schematu uwierzytelniania tworzącego plik cookie

CookieOptions

Opcje tworzenia wychodzącego pliku cookie. Może zostać zamieniony lub zmieniony podczas wywołania signingIn.

HttpContext

Obiekt kontekstu przekazany do obiektu SigningIn(CookieSigningInContext).

(Odziedziczone po BaseContext)
HttpContext

Kontekst.

(Odziedziczone po BaseContext<TOptions>)
Options

Obiekt kontekstu przekazany do obiektu SigningIn(CookieSigningInContext).

(Odziedziczone po BaseCookieContext)
Options

Pobiera opcje uwierzytelniania skojarzone ze schematem.

(Odziedziczone po BaseContext<TOptions>)
Principal

Zawiera oświadczenia, które mają zostać przekonwertowane na wychodzący plik cookie. Może zostać zastąpiony lub zmieniony podczas wywołania usługi SigningIn.

Principal

ClaimsPrincipal Pobiera zawierające oświadczenia użytkownika.

(Odziedziczone po PrincipalContext<TOptions>)
Properties

Zawiera dodatkowe dane, które mają być zawarte w wychodzącym pliku cookie. Może zostać zastąpiony lub zmieniony podczas wywołania usługi SigningIn.

Properties

Pobiera lub ustawia wartość AuthenticationProperties.

(Odziedziczone po PropertiesContext<TOptions>)
Request

Obiekt kontekstu przekazany do obiektu SigningIn(CookieSigningInContext).

(Odziedziczone po BaseContext)
Request

Żądanie.

(Odziedziczone po BaseContext<TOptions>)
Response

Obiekt kontekstu przekazany do obiektu SigningIn(CookieSigningInContext).

(Odziedziczone po BaseContext)
Response

Odpowiedź.

(Odziedziczone po BaseContext<TOptions>)
Scheme

Schemat uwierzytelniania.

(Odziedziczone po BaseContext<TOptions>)

Dotyczy